Epithet: schlechteri
Derivation: Honors the German taxonomist, botanist, and orchidologist Friedrich Richard Rudolf Schlechter (1872-1925) or his brother Max Schlechter (1874-1960) or both.
Pronunciation: SCHLEK-ter-eye
